    What Sets Citicoline Sodium Apart?

    Walking down any supplement aisle or scrolling through pharmaceutical suppliers, you’ll spot a crowded field: choline bitartrate, Alpha-GPC, phosphatidylcholine, and countless unnamed “brain” blends. Citicoline sodium carves out its own space. It crosses the blood-brain barrier efficiently, supporting both neuronal membrane repair and neurotransmitter synthesis—a dual-action path far more direct than standard choline salts.

    Many in my field grew wary of slick marketing claims focusing on “bioavailable choline,” but few actually deliver cytidine along with choline. Both are essential for a critical neurotransmitter, acetylcholine, and for the regenerating process of cell membranes. My own review of clinical data found that patients receiving citicoline sodium, particularly post-stroke, saw measurable improvements in cognitive recovery—a result not widely shared with less robust substitutes.

    Citicoline’s metabolism, backed by peer-reviewed studies, avoids unnecessary build-up of intermediaries. Unlike other choline sources, less conversion “work” falls on the liver and intestines. That efficiency means users report better tolerance, with fewer gastro complaints or headaches.     Comparing Citicoline Sodium to Other Compounds

    Competitors like Alpha-GPC or choline chloride come with their own upsides, but none combine both cytidine and choline support. Many choline-focused supplements simply flood the body with raw material, leaving much of the work to the body’s own synthetic machinery. Citicoline sodium, in contrast, packs a one-two punch: both essential building blocks are readily available, speeding up and smoothing out the physiological processes that matter for memory and learning.

    Applications Beyond the Capsule or Tablet

    Pharmacists recognize citicoline sodium’s utility not just in oral supplements, but also in injectables, eye care formulas for glaucoma support, and even liquid suspensions for pediatric or geriatric use. Real-world caregivers prioritize ingredients that dissolve completely, retain stability, and avoid troublesome preservatives. My own work with neurological clinics showed a preference for BP/USP/EP/CP specification powders, which translated to fewer compounding errors and more consistent dosing—critical in populations where missing a dose could derail months of progress.

    Ophthalmologists and eye care specialists have also shown growing interest. Citicoline’s membrane-restoring properties mean it’s often included in advanced eye drops or solutions. Across these diverse applications, citicoline sodium’s role expands well beyond traditional “cognitive support” supplements; it has become a multi-faceted tool for patient care.
